Zirconium doped LiTi 2 (PO 4 ) 3 (LTP) samples with the chemical composition of Li[Ti 2−x Zr x ](PO 4 ) 3 (x=0.0, 0.1, 0.3 and 0.5) are prepared by solid state reaction method. XRD data revealed the formation of phase pure materials of rhombohedral structure with space group R3¯c(#167). Microstructural studies by scanning electron microscopy indicated that the particle size is in the range of 0.5–1μm. Raman spectroscopic study showed that the peaks at high frequencies are due to intramolecular PO 4 3− stretching modes. Electrochemical impedance studies showed high ionic conductivity for small amount of Zirconium (x=0.1) doping.
